. This is a writing intensive class, so you should carefully look at my style sheet before submitting your paper. These writing tips are requirements, not suggestions, and those who ignore them will receive a lower grade. I certainly don’t expect a perfectly written paper (which I’m not capable of writing either), but I hope to see evidence that you have read the comments that I made on your first paper when I grade your second and third papers.
In your essays you should provide an analysis of the assertions in the news article using concepts that you have learned in class. You may want to begin your paper with a one paragraph summary of the article, but don’t spend too much time summarizing the article. If you are having trouble getting started, you might begin by making notes about the variables discussed in the article. Often articles will argue that one economic factor is influencing another. For instance, inflation might impact interest rates. You can then explain the underlying reasons why this would occur. The textbook can help here. Feel free to offer other explanations for the events discussed in the article. You are even free to criticize an assertion in the article if you think it is wrong. I will grade you more on the quality of your argument, than on whether I happen to think it is right or wrong. I do not provide feedback on rough drafts, but I am happy to give you advice and/or answer any questions you have.
You should never paraphrase statements made in the article. Either provide an exact quotation (with quotation marks), or make the point in your own words. The most common mistake made by students in the past is to just summarize the article that they have attached. The second most common mistake is when students focus so much on their own opinions that they virtually ignore what the article is saying. Try to be somewhere in the middle. For instance, try not to just say �The article says X . . . I agree�. Instead, try to say something like �The article says X . . . and what that means is . . .� Imagine your are explaining it to a non-EC/FI student. Again, try to use class concepts in your analysis.

Employment Law “Standard Implied Terms” Custom Essay

[meteor_slideshow slideshow=”arp1″]

The following cases should be use to compare and contrast answers.
� To obey lawful and reasonable orders

Pepper v Webb (1969)

Morrish v Henlys (Folkestone) Ltd (1973)

TURERA 1993

� To act with loyalty

Faccenda Chicken Ltd v Fowler (1986)

Hivac Ltd v Park Royal Scientific Instruments Ltd. (1946)

� To act with skill and care

Litster v Romford Ice and Cold Storage Co. Ltd. (1957)

Janata Bank v Ahmed (1981)

� Not to take bribes or secret profits

Reading v AG (1951
